Transaction f76b21fa63da9b39bbe3ed1776501c0c054ece1e331c3adba939004658a25508

1 Input
2 Outputs
  • f76b21fa63da9b39bbe3ed1776501c0c054ece1e331c3adba939004658a25508:0
  • value  128456
    address  3Qo62a22nygnpKuKnHzhrQJLNdp3GprEL1
  • f76b21fa63da9b39bbe3ed1776501c0c054ece1e331c3adba939004658a25508:1
  • value  5672
    address  34wQm91k2sCGDdAy6FZxxgNXPa8RMEfdkw